Kane Manera: Back to No Goodo on Guiding Light

Kane Manera is reprising his role as "G" next month on Guiding Light. Look for him to appear on June 2.

For those of you who don't recall, this character was Daisy's former, even boyfriend. He also mugged Ava and was responsible for murdering Tammy. Tough resume.

After Remy beat him within an inch of his life, "G" was exiled back to Australia. The returning character will immediately cause trouble for Daisy and, according to gossip, he may be related to Cyrus in some way.

Heather Tom to Donate Dress Off Her Back

Good for Heather Tom!

To celebrate her 12th Daytime Emmy nomination, The Bold and the Beautiful actress has asked Project Runway's Jack Mackenroth to design a one-of-a-kind gown that she'll auction off after wearing it for the the June 20 event. Proceeds will benefit AIDS charities.

The auction, hosted by the Clothes Off Our Back Foundation, kicks off June 27, also known as National HIV Testing Day. It's an important cause.

Cameron Mathison to Co-Host Daytime Emmy Awards

Cameron Mathison is always in demand.

The amiable All My Children star has signed on for yet another hosting gig, this one close to the hearts of all soap fans: he'll be co-hosting the 35th Annual Daytime Emmy Awards with Sherri Shepherd of The View.

This is Mathison's first time hosting the Emmys, but he's got plenty of experience with the microphone. The star has hosted SOAPnet's I Wanna Be a Soap Star for four seasons and he's been tapped to host TLC's new game show Your Place or Mine, as well.

The Daytime Emmys will be broadcast live from the Kodak Theatre on June 20 on ABC.

Cynthia Sikes Cast on The Young and the Restless

Katy Perry appearing on the show isn't the only The Young and the Restless spoiler we have for fans today.

Cynthia Sikes has been cast as Sabrina's mother, Zara. The actress will start taping May 27.

The character is set to arrive in Genoa City on June 19, just in time for her daughter's wedding to Victor. The Young and the Restless had to do some quick recasting after Finola Hughes (Anna, General Hospital) was set to take on the role, but General Hospital asked her not to.

As far as Sikes is concerned, she's been acting for over three decades with shows such as Jag and St. Elsewhere on her resume.

Katy Perry to Appear on The Young and the Restless

Singer Katy Perry will appear as herself on The Young and the Restless on June 12.

Perry, whose single ''I Kissed a Girl'' resides in the top 10 on iTunes, will tape scenes in which she's at a photo shoot for the show's new fashion magazine, Restless Style. Look for her as second cover girl for the magazine, which launched an online component last week, restlessstyle.com.

Hunter Tylo: Turning Tragedy to Triumph

Hunter Tylo is trying to turn tragedy into triumph.

The Bold and the Beautiful actress has joined forces with the newly organized American Epilepsy Outreach Foundation (AEOF) to help raise awareness of the neurological disorder that affects more than three million people in the country. Her goal is to educate the public on first aid for someone experiencing a seizure.

Tylo helped the foundation in honor of her son Mickey, who died of a seizure-related accident in October.

Through its website, www.epilepsyoutreach.org, AEOF offers information on detecting and treating seizure disorders, first aid information for someone experiencing a seizure, links to a variety of related resources and an outlet to share personal stories. The organization also distributes first aid information to schools and other public venues.
